Output 58648b7cd203a1fe044f9af14c125e94a1a3c8df7eace9af46aa06ed27ec4b2f:0

value
266806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08bd4cb6d5908e215dfc376b52b0facc3f59a3f4 OP_EQUAL
address
32VE6rEcyCZqfk4PiN9BzKXPK6S6vqWG6j
transaction
58648b7cd203a1fe044f9af14c125e94a1a3c8df7eace9af46aa06ed27ec4b2f
spent
true